Abstract

Rapid advances in the technologies of wireless communication have led to the evolution and empowerment of Wireless Body Area Network (WBAN). The health care applications are improved by using WBAN with the usage of different variety of sensors for monitoring the patient in order to diagnose any life threatening diseases. In recent past, several experts have concentrated in building system architecture of WBAN to enhance technical requirements for health care monitoring applications. These wearable systems play an important role since they control the life of patient. Although, Wireless Body Area Networks (WBAN) is an emerging key technology which is used for providing real-time monitoring of the patient health condition, WBAN faces various issues like energy efficiency, quality of service (QoS), along with security issues such as loss of data, authentication, access control and privacy issues. Very few researchers have developed strong security system for WBAN in order to protect the life-critical data. However, WBANs face some difficulties in addressing security since it has arduous resource constraints and strident environmental conditions. Hence, security and privacy is a challenging task. In this paper, a general outlook of Wireless Body Area Network and Wireless Sensor Network is given. Further the survey of different protocols using essential security and privacy issues with its pro and cons in WBANs.
